Meat and Veg
Most low carb diets allow for quite a variety of choices, the number one choice on the low carb menu are vegetables. While nothing is carb free, vegetables are the closest thing to it that contain nutritional value. Greens such as lettuce, spinach and celery are top of the pile. Not all vegetables are ideal though, it is probably best to avoid potatoes, corn and carrots as they contain a high level of carbohydrates.

The result
A good diet will contain lots of protein and a healthy dose of fats, whilst keeping the carb count low. The function of carbohydrates is to provide the body with enough energy to keep working throughout the day. When you lower you carb intake, the body turns to the fat stores for energy, this is how you lose weight on any low carb diet.
Therefore, it is advised that athletes or extremely active people do not take advantage of low carb diet recipes as you will need the energy to get the most out of your day. For everyone else however, having a low carb diet can help remove those layers of fat that are inhibiting you.
